This middle access point on Lake Chicot provides convenient launch facilities for kayakers, canoeists, and motorboats on one of South Central Louisiana's premier freshwater destinations. Located in Evangeline Parish, this ramp is part of the Lake Chicot access system, which includes multiple launch points around the 2,000-acre lake. The cool, clear waters support excellent fishing opportunities for largemouth bass, crappie, bluegill, and red-ear sunfish, making it popular with anglers as well as paddlers.
Lake Chicot State Park encompasses over 6,400 acres of rolling hills and water, with additional amenities including a boathouse, boat rentals, and picnic facilities. Paddlers should note that multiple ramps are available around the lake—two boat ramps are located on the south side at Chicot County Park, while Lake Chicot State Park features additional launches on the north shore. This middle access point offers a good central option for exploring the expansive lake. The park is open year-round and accommodates day-use visitors and overnight guests with camping, cabins, and lodge accommodations available.
